Answer:

The equation of the hypotenuse line is y = -3·x + 9

Therefore, the correct options are -3 and 9

Step-by-step explanation:

The question asks to fill the boxes

y = _ x + _

We note that the equation is that of a straight line of the form;

y = m·x + c

Where:

m = Slope of the straight line graph and

c = Y intercept, that is the y-coordinate of the point on the line where x = 0

From the graph, we find the slope as follows;

Slope = \frac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 -x_1} = \frac{(-9) -0}{6-3} = -3

Therefore, m = -3

The y intercept is found by extending the hypotenuse line to the point where it touches the y axes that is at x = 0;

From the graph, it is observed that the line, when extended, touches the y axes at the point y = 9, therefore, c = 9

Hence we have, the equation of the hypotenuse line is y = -3·x + 9.
